Originally Posted by supercharged03gt View Post
I dont understand why I get terrible gas mailage when the worlds fastes car the ssc ultimat aero can get 18 city and 27 mpg on the highway. Im jealous
That's when driven like a granny. It is also turbo charged, which increases gas mileage. And it has a six speed which = better gas mileage compared to a five speed. And, it weighs 2750 lbs, so being about 500-600 lbs less then you... means better gas mileage. Also, it isn't called the ultimate aero for nothing. It has phenominal areodynamics and it literally sits on the ground , which, yet again, means better gas mileage.
